A Faculty Assistant is responsible for providing quality administrative and technical support to a group of professors, facilitating their teaching and research.
S/he must organise and complete a high volume of work and reconcile conflicting demands, prioritising varied and often last-minute requests and ensuring that all deadlines are respected.
The job holder will be responsible for the following critical tasks:
1. Course Administration
- Work collaboratively with Faculty, anticipating all course requirements.
- Interact with speakers, tutors, teaching assistants and graders.
- Compile and verify the course package.
- Submit the materials for copyright permission/clearance using an online tool.
- Liaise with the Printshop, IT, Multimedia and Campus services teams.
- Organise logistics for simulations, quizzes and exercises.
- Create and update course websites; manage online polls/surveys.
- Liaise with the Degree Program Teams for the smooth running of the exam logistics.
- Compile, verify and enter the grades into the system with the utmost accountability and confidentiality.
2. Office Administration
- Organise meetings, video and conference calls with both internal and external parties.
- Coordinate travel arrangements for teaching, conferences and other trip purposes: visas, passports and travel plans.
- Request on/offcampus conference budgets.
- Filter, process and follow up on Faculty professional expenses.
- Design, update and proofread documents.
- Handle multiple, complex agendas.
- Translate letters and/or short nontechnical documents occasionally (Europe Campus only).
- Contribute to the Faculty Evaluation Committee administrative process.
3. Research
- Assist in research, datamining and information compilation.
- Format research documents: cases, papers, and books.
- Create and update databases, surveys and bibliographies.
- Proofread and edit the format of the articles according to journal guidelines.
- Coordinate with Research Assistant(s)/Co-Author(s) for meetings, trips and expenses.
4. Additional responsibilities
- Area Seminars: organise the guest speaker(s) visits, responsible for logistics (IT, multimedia, room booking, campus services, catering and travel arrangements)
- Oncampus conferences and events.
- New Faculty: ensure integration
- Coordination between the Faculty members and the EDP team (client manager(s) and programme coordinator(s)).
- Prepare and send recommendation letters for graduating PhD students.
- Technical university diploma (2 years) or an administrative degree.
- Excellent level of English, fluent in French.
- Excellent organisation skills and attention to detail.
- Highly flexible and adaptable with strong interpersonal and communication skills.
- Sense of initiative and proactiveness.
- Ability to prioritise, set and meet deadlines.
- Excellent team spirit and player, with ability ty to work autonomously.
- Excellent computer skills.
